Caring Transitions of The Woodlands is looking for new Estate Sale and Move Team Members to assist with our online auction, estate services, and relocation projects. We work in clients' homes in The Woodlands, Montgomery, Conroe, Magnolia, and surrounding areas. Caring Transitions is the nation's largest provider of transition services, helping seniors and family members navigate the difficult process of rightsizing (downsizing).

We are seeking compassionate, caring, and mature individuals capable of performing assigned tasks with limited supervision.

These positions are part-time on an as-needed basis, with potential for promotion to a team lead role after training and experience.

Knowledge of antiques, collectibles, household goods, and experience with packing and organizing is a plus. Must be able to lift 50 pounds, be on your feet for most of the day, and enjoy a fast-paced work environment.

Job Responsibilities:
  • Organize and sort household goods for distribution and sale
  • Declutter by separating low, medium, and high-value items
  • Take and edit digital merchandise photos on a handheld device
  • Prepare descriptions of items and upload photos
  • Greet customers and provide service during auction pick-up
  • Clean out at the end of the sale
Relocations and Right-Sizing:
  • Use proper packing techniques for relocation
  • Unpack and resettle items in new homes
  • Assist with decluttering and downsizing
  • Transport moving supplies and boxes within a client's home
Qualifications:
  • Compassion and respect for clients and their families
  • Strong verbal communication skills and fluency in English
  • Trustworthy, reliable, and self-directed
  • Ability to complete tasks in fast-paced, changing environments
  • Willingness to work in cluttered and/or dirty environments (gloves, aprons, etc. provided)
  • Excellent organizational and prioritization skills
  • Punctuality and attention to detail
  • Reliable transportation and smartphone access
